Experience a convenient and eco-friendly way to dispose of your tree branches with the Summer Woodchipping Service. This service is designed especially for Sutherland Shire residents to help manage garden waste responsibly during the daylight saving months. It’s a great opportunity to clear your yard while contributing to sustainable waste management.
You will be required to load branches into your car or trailer with the cut end facing the rear. Council staff will unload the branches while you remain safely in your vehicle. You can also take home mulch by bringing your own buckets.
Please note that only cars, cars with trailers, and utilities are admitted, and tree cuttings must be between one metre and 250 mm in diameter. Smaller branches can be disposed of in your green lid bin.
The woodchipping service will be held on Saturday, 14 March 2026, from 09:00 to 15:00 at the Council Depot located at 13-15 Ethell Road, Kirrawee. This event is free of charge and open exclusively to residents of Sutherland Shire.
Certain materials are not accepted, including lawn clippings, stumps, spiky or thorny materials, household waste, and commercial or demolition waste. Approval may be required for tree removal or lopping, so please check with the Council’s Tree Preservation Officer if needed.
The woodchipper machine itself will not be onsite on the day. The service may be cancelled due to bad weather, with updates posted on the Council’s website.
